Defining Haute Couture: A Look at Luxury Fashion Brands

Haute couture, a term that evokes images of exquisite garments and unparalleled craftsmanship, illustrates the pinnacle of luxury fashion. These prestigious ateliers, often situated in Paris, produce limited-edition collections for discerning clientele who demand the supreme in style and quality.

Each garment is meticulously crafted by skilled artisans, using only the finest materials. With delicate embroidery to intricate beadwork, every detail is meticulously attended to, transforming materials into wearable works of art. Haute couture transcends simple fashion; it embodies a legacy of tradition, innovation, and the pursuit of masterpiece.

Sustainable Opulence: Luxury Brands Embracing Ethical Practices

Luxury brands are adapting their image to encompass ethical production. Consumers are increasingly demanding transparency and responsibility, driving premium houses to implement sustainable practices throughout their supply chains. From sourcing ingredients with a reduced environmental impact to reducing waste and emissions, these brands aspire to define opulence as a force for good.

  • Many luxury brands are now collaborating with NGOs to preserve vulnerable ecosystems and endangered species.
  • There is a growing trend towards recycling within the luxury sector, with brands designing products that are long-lasting and can be repaired at the end of their life cycle.
  • Consumers are welcoming these efforts, as they desire to indulge in luxury that aligns with their beliefs.

Finally, sustainable opulence is not about Luxury fashion brands compromising quality or craftsmanship, but rather transforming it by incorporating ethical and environmental considerations. As understanding continues to grow, luxury brands that embrace sustainability will thrive in the future.
